| | It was a fifth consecutive positive week for the General Electric (GE). During the week, the GE gained 3.00 points, or 1.46%, and closed at 208.30 on Friday, February 14, 2025. Weekly volume was -27% below average.
Long-term trend: [See GE long-term trend chart] A long-term uptrend had started on January 3, 2023 at 65.21 and reached 211.40 on February 12, 2025. GE gained -146.19 points, or -224.18%, in 110 weeks. Price is near the trend high.
Medium-term trend: [See GE medium-term trend chart] A medium-term uptrend had started on December 18, 2024 at 159.60 and reached 211.40 on February 12, 2025. GE gained -51.80 points, or -32.46%, in 8 weeks. The price is now at the 5.98% retracement level.
Weekly Technical Indicators: [See GE weekly technical indicators chart] Weekly Lane's Stochastic is overbought while Williams' Percentage Range is strongly overbought. Oscillators are designed to signal a possible trend reversal. They can act as alerts and should be taken in conjunction with other technical analysis tools. The weekly MACD line is above its signal line since January 24, 2025. This is an indication that the medium-term trend is up. Use the following link to access a MACD help.
Short-term trend: [See GE short-term trend chart] A short-term uptrend had started on January 28, 2025 at 191.80 and reached 211.40 on February 12, 2025. GE gained -19.60 points, or -10.22%, in 15 days. The price is now at the 15.82% retracement level.
Daily Technical Indicators: [See GE daily technical indicators chart] Daily Lane's Stochastic is overbought while Williams' Percentage Range is strongly overbought. During the last week, daily MACD line has moved below its signal line. Such crossover is considered a bearish signal. During the last week, the price has fallen below the Parabolic SAR (stop and reversal). A Parabolic SAR above the price is a bearish signal, and it indicates that momentum is likely to remain in the downward direction. A Parabolic SAR is used as a trailing stop loss for long or short positions. It works best during strong trending periods.
